Coming to architecture, the human mind is so creative that millions of architectural designs have poured out over centuries. When you look at the multiple wonders of the old and modern world, one thing always stands out; Each wonder is so unique, so creatively crafted and infused with the culture of the makers. There is no way you will see a Pyramid of Giza and mistake it to belong to people outside of the Egyptians. There is no way you will walk into a Shaolin temple or stand atop The Great Wall, and not immediately peg it to the Chinese. The Mayan ruins to the Mayans, the Great wall of Benin to the Benin’s and by extension, Nigerians.
Now when we come to modern times, I know we’ve had that thought that it has become even more tricky to tell what cultural infusion has been applied in our urban world, since a lot of structures look “one and the same”, and are following similar patterns and rule books. Truly, life after colonialism has made people, practices, cultures and even structures, different. But there is still always a way to tell. The truth is, as long as there is life, there will always be culture, and as long as there is culture, culture will find its way into our architectural spaces and urban communities. You’d see that in statues and monuments strategically positioned in different areas of a community. You could also see that in various artistic home décor littered through a person’s home.
When you walk into a modern home, there is always going to be a form of cultural expression that tells you about their tastes, preferences, and also their ethnicity.
